This is Oddmall is track #9 on the CD Odds and Ends, Rarities & Remixes by Stratos (Bailey Records / May 12, 2009).

This is Oddmall is a quirky, experimental track featuring an accordion, acoustic guitars, bull frogs, and other eclectic sounds in addition to the synths and drum machines one comes to expect from a Stratos tune.  This is Oddmall is the theme song of Oddmall: Emporium of the Weird hosted by Mutha Oith Creations (http://www.muthaoithcreations.com).

When Andy Hopp was brainstorming and promoting his ideas for a new craft-type show that featured off-the-wall stuff, the idea of a theme song came to fruition and bizarre concepts were tossed around.  The whole process, including the idea of having a theme song, was silly to say the least but Stratos ran with the idea and a few months later - at the first Oddmall show in 2009 - This is Oddmall made its debut.  This is Oddmall is part of the Miscellaneous Universe catalog from Bailey Records.

Scanned image
These products were created by scanning an original printed edition. Most older books are in scanned image format because original digital layout files never existed or were no longer available from the publisher.

For PDF download editions, each page has been run through Optical Character Recognition (OCR) software to attempt to decipher the printed text. The result of this OCR process is placed invisibly behind the picture of each scanned page, to allow for text searching. However, any text in a given book set on a graphical background or in handwritten fonts would most likely not be picked up by the OCR software, and is therefore not searchable. Also, a few larger books may be resampled to fit into the system, and may not have this searchable text background.

For printed books, we have performed high-resolution scans of an original hardcopy of the book. We essentially digitally re-master the book. Unfortunately, the resulting quality of these books is not as high. It's the problem of making a copy of a copy. The text is fine for reading, but illustration work starts to run dark, pixellating and/or losing shades of grey. Moiré patterns may develop in photos. We mark clearly which print titles come from scanned image books so that you can make an informed purchase decision about the quality of what you will receive.
